Unlock the Fascinating World of Nature's Master Graspers
What allows a monkey to swing effortlessly through the forest canopy? How can an elephant's trunk delicately pick up a single blade of grass while also moving massive objects? Why are octopus arms among the most flexible and intelligent appendages in the animal kingdom? The answer lies in one of nature's most extraordinary adaptations: prehensility.
The Hidden Science of Prehensility is a comprehensive and engaging exploration of the anatomy, evolution, behavior, biomechanics, ecology, conservation, and technological significance of grasping adaptations across the animal kingdom. Designed for students, educators, wildlife enthusiasts, researchers, and curious readers, this book provides an in-depth understanding of how animals use specialized structures to grasp, manipulate, climb, communicate, defend themselves, care for offspring, and thrive in diverse environments.
Through clear explanations and fascinating examples, you will discover how prehensile tails, trunks, tentacles, hands, feet, and other gripping structures have evolved independently across multiple species, creating some of the most remarkable survival tools in nature.
Inside this book, you'll explore:
• The anatomy and biological foundations of prehensile structures
• The evolutionary pathways that shaped grasping adaptations
• Mammals, reptiles, and marine animals with extraordinary prehensile abilities
• The biomechanics of gripping, climbing, suspension, and movement
• Sensory systems that enable precise control and coordination
• Feeding, foraging, communication, parenting, and social behaviors
• Habitat influences on the development of prehensility
• Conservation challenges facing prehensile species worldwide
• Scientific research uncovering new insights into animal adaptation
• Biomimicry and the influence of prehensility on robotics, prosthetics, and modern engineering
Combining scientific accuracy with accessible explanations, this handbook reveals the interconnected relationship between anatomy, behavior, ecology, and evolution. It demonstrates how a single adaptation can transform the way animals interact with their environment and how these natural innovations continue to inspire cutting-edge technologies.
Whether you are passionate about wildlife, biology, evolution, or technological innovation, The Hidden Science of Prehensility offers a captivating journey into one of nature's most versatile and ingenious adaptations.
Discover how the power to grasp has shaped life on Earth and continues to inspire the future.
